projects
/
librecmc
/
librecmc.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
71e8619
)
gpio-nct5104d: add compatibility for linux 4.9
author
Felix Fietkau
<nbd@nbd.name>
Fri, 27 Jan 2017 10:55:12 +0000
(11:55 +0100)
committer
Felix Fietkau
<nbd@nbd.name>
Wed, 1 Feb 2017 16:49:52 +0000
(17:49 +0100)
Signed-off-by: Felix Fietkau <nbd@nbd.name>
package/kernel/gpio-nct5104d/src/gpio-nct5104d.c
patch
|
blob
|
history
diff --git
a/package/kernel/gpio-nct5104d/src/gpio-nct5104d.c
b/package/kernel/gpio-nct5104d/src/gpio-nct5104d.c
index a37a1d056d07e66a5a2e26b1b04609daee184580..1ad1a6b10a0a81202be2d688398c45ebe76134b7 100644
(file)
--- a/
package/kernel/gpio-nct5104d/src/gpio-nct5104d.c
+++ b/
package/kernel/gpio-nct5104d/src/gpio-nct5104d.c
@@
-275,7
+275,11
@@
static int nct5104d_gpio_probe(struct platform_device *pdev)
for (i = 0; i < data->nr_bank; i++) {
struct nct5104d_gpio_bank *bank = &data->bank[i];
+#if LINUX_VERSION_CODE < KERNEL_VERSION(4,5,0)
bank->chip.dev = &pdev->dev;
+#else
+ bank->chip.parent = &pdev->dev;
+#endif
bank->data = data;
err = gpiochip_add(&bank->chip);